The influence of franchisee loss on logistics network: A new perspective from NK model
Swarm and Evolutionary Computation ( IF 8.2 ) Pub Date : 2019-10-19 , DOI: 10.1016/j.swevo.2019.100595
Yihang Feng , Bin Hu , Changying Ke

Franchisee has become a powerful tool for many logistics enterprises in affiliate mode to seize market share. But affiliate mode has emerged many drawbacks that can aggravate the divergence of interests between franchisees and headquarter and then leads to the problem of franchisee loss. In this paper, the franchisee loss problem is studied from the perspective of vulnerability. The loss of a franchisee is seen as a node that has been attacked. The performance change before and after an attack is used to reflect the strength of a network’s vulnerability. Efficacy and efficiency are proposed to measure the performance change based on NK model, which specializes in studying complex adaptive system such as logistics network. Results show that efficacy and efficiency vary according to network scale. For relatively small networks, their efficacy shows more obvious fluctuation with the variation of network scale than efficiency does. In these networks, the redundancy of network nodes is high. But the percentage of redundant nodes decreases with the increase of scale and the efficacy can be improved with the reduction of redundant nodes. The network structure of them is not stable. As for relatively large networks, efficiency fluctuates more apparently with the change of complexity than efficacy does. In these networks, most nodes are influential and the percentage of influential nodes shows obvious change with complexity. The network structure tends to be stable. In conclusion, the study on the influence of franchisee loss from vulnerability can provide us with greater visibility and insight into the organization structure of logistics networks. Corresponding cases are introduced to confirm our conclusions.
